Phi Per is a B2Vpe-type star located in the constellation of Perseus. Sitting at a distance of approximately 718 ly from Earth, it shines with an apparent magnitude of 4.01, making it an interesting target for observation. It is officially recorded in the Hipparcos catalog as HIP 8068.
